Good afternoon, I came across the following problem and I couldn't find a way to solve it
"Given the following pieces of information:
$a>0$
$R=${$(x,y) \in \mathbb{R}^2|x \geq 0,a \leq y\leq −ln(ax)$}, where $S$ is a solid obtained by the revolution of the area $R$ around the $x$ axis
find the value of $a$, knowing that the volume of $S$ is equal to $4$"
I tried to integrate and apply the method to find the volume of the solids of revolution but I can never get rid of this constant a Does anyone know how I can solve this problem?
